Venus Pipes posts steady FY26, with net profit up 9.8%
Q4 revenue rose 17% year-on-year. The board also approved a final dividend of ₹0.50 per share.

The full read
Venus Pipes closed FY26 with steady, unspectacular numbers. Full-year net profit rose 9.8% year-on-year, while the fourth quarter reported a sharper 17% revenue jump. That gap suggests the final quarter carried more weight, either from a softer base in Q4 FY25 or an acceleration in the business. The board declared a final dividend of ₹0.50 per share, a small and routine gesture. It also reappointed the internal and cost auditors.
